Rutland Township Board and guests spoke with the Board about their concerns with the Bowens Mill Bridge over Glass Creek being closed and the funding to open it back up.

 

Motion was made and seconded to table any action on the Bowens Mill Bridge over Glass Creek for 90 to 120 days to pursue alternate solutions to get the bridge open.

 

     ROLL CALL:  Yeas, Willcutt, Dykstra, & Fiala

                               Nays, None

                               Motion Carried

Motion was made and seconded to allow all contractors bidding on the Finkbeiner/Crane Road Project to purchase Bank Run Sand from the Road Commission at a cost of $2.50 per cubic yard with the contractor loading the material and to allow the muck from the project to be stockpiled at the Bender Pit.

 

     ROLL CALL:  Yeas, Willcutt, Dykstra, & Fiala

                               Nays, None

                               Motion Carried
